The fact is these days you can find so much more to DVD Players than just viewing dvds. Any more sophisticated models provide high quality sound and video connections providing clean clear images and amazing surround sound. In addition to playing recordable and re-writable Compact disks they can easily deal with your current MP3 mix discs, some can also play WMA (Windows Media Audio) files. A number of Players have got SACD (Super Audio CDs) or DVD audio decoding for high resolution multi channel music.
Undoubtedly the ideal DVD Player for you personally is definitely the only one which best satisfies your requirements it ought to possess the features that matter most for you. For example, when you still have got (and watch) lots of VHS videos then a DVD/VCR Combo Player is actually a excellent choice. These are generally really affordable and also give the familiarity of the VCR Player while using enhanced music and also movie quality of DVD. You can easily use it to record your favourite Television shows on VHS, watch movies on DVD as well as listen to your audio Compact disks. In the event that you need to archive your VHS videos think about a DVD Recorder which provide convenient tape-free recording with the features of a DVD Player. You can easily also back up home movies on to DVD. You will find a number of writeable and rewrite able formats on the market to let you use the right disk for the right task.
When you travel a lot some sort of Portable DVD Player could be the solution. These are generally compact and also lightweight and quite a few additionally provide twin headphone jacks allowing several people to listen simultaneously. Lots of these kind of portable players are generally car-friendly too due to the fact in addition to having standard rechargeable electric batteries quite a few also come with features like cigarette lighter power adapters as well as automobile installation kits.
A large part of choosing the correct player is being sure it's got all of the required connections to do with your different audio visual gear. Nearly all current DVD Players have got a minimum of 3 video jacks composite, S-video and component. Component inputs are usually only found on mid-priced to high end Tvs built within the last few years. The component connection gives the most effective picture quality. When your Television just has an antenna style RF input you'll have to fit an RF modulator between the TV and DVD Player. Also a DVD/VCR Combo may be worth thinking about since a few can pass DVD signals via their RF output.
